Asphalt Works Continue at the Junction of Szoboszlói Road and Külsővásártér

The contractor carrying out the capacity expansion works at the junction of Szoboszlói Road and Külsővásártér junction commenced road surface renovation works on 26 February 2026. On 3 March 2026, the laying of the asphalt wearing course on Nyugati Street began, with further phases of work to follow.

Subject to weather conditions, the contractor plans to carry out the asphalt works as follows:
• On 4 March 2026 (Wednesday), laying of the asphalt base and binder courses on the city-centre side of Erzsébet Street;
• On 5–6 March 2026 (Thursday and Friday), raising and concreting of the existing manhole covers on the city-centre side of Erzsébet Street;
• On 9–10 March 2026 (Monday and Tuesday), laying of the asphalt wearing course on the city-centre side of Erzsébet Street.

Daytime asphalting works will be carried out with traffic controlled by banksmen, between the morning and afternoon peak periods.

In order to minimise disruption to traffic, junction asphalting works will take place at night (between 22:00 and 05:00) as follows:
• On 5–6 March 2026 (Thursday and Friday) at the Széchényi Street – Külsővásártér – Nyugati Street junction;
• On 11–13 March 2026 (Wednesday, Thursday and Friday) at the Miklós Street – Külsővásártér – Erzsébet Street junction.

During the night works, between 22:00 on 5 March 2026 and 05:00 on 6 March 2026, Széchényi Street will be closed in its full width from the access road of the Lidl store to the main entrance of Debreceni SZC Mechwart András Technical School of Engineering and Information Technology. During this period, it will not be possible to turn into Széchényi Street from the direction of Külsővásártér or Nyugati Street. Diversions will be available via Szoboszlói Road or Kishegyesi Road. Traffic will be managed by banksmen.

Between 11 and 13 March 2026, during the night works, Miklós Street will be closed in its full width from Szív Street to Erzsébet Street. The diversion route will be provided via Antall József Street.

Due to the works, traffic congestion can be expected. All road users are therefore requested, where possible, to avoid the affected streets and junctions and to follow the temporary traffic signs in place rather than their usual routes.
